Subject: Key rotation for Snapglass snapshot service

Heads up to future maintainers: the credential used by our UI snapshot-testing pipeline (Snapglass) was rotated this morning as part of quarterly hygiene. All component baseline uploads now authenticate with the new key. Update your local runner config before regenerating snapshots, or diffs will silently fail. The current key for the Snapglass internal API is provided below.

gateway credential: kto23_LX9A4ys6i4nzHtpOLNLodKK

Handover from Priya to the new folks on the Crumbline team. The order-cutoff rule for Morrowfield Bakery is enforced in the ordering service, not the storefront: orders placed after the cutoff roll to the next bake day, and holidays are read from a calendar table, never hardcoded. Don't trust the storefront countdown timer — it's cosmetic and drifts. If the two disagree, the service wins. Everything the cutoff evaluator needs lives in its config, reproduced below for reference.

config for kafof-bawef:
holath:
  log_level: debug
  metrics_host: metrics.holath.qorvelsys.internal
  pin: 2191
  pool_size: 32

**Q: Are the lifts running this weekend?** No. Both lifts in the Halloway Annexe are down for winch maintenance Saturday 06:00 to Sunday 18:00. Direct staff to the east stairwell. Goods deliveries should be deferred or rerouted via the Penfold loading dock. Contractors from Bray Vertical Systems will be on site; they sign in at the facilities desk as normal. The stairwell door locks after 19:00, so anyone working late will need the weekend access code. Issue it only to rostered staff. The code is below.

badge for bawef-bahap: bdg-LALUM-4

Flaky DNS in the Hollowpine plugin host. Symptoms: intermittent resolution failures for plugin registry lookups, usually under parallel installs. Cause: the embedded resolver caches NXDOMAIN aggressively. Workaround for plugin authors: retry with backoff (3 attempts, 2s base) rather than failing fast. Do not hardcode registry addresses; the mirror rotation will break you. If retries exhaust, capture the resolver log and file against the host, not your plugin. Include with your report the trace token printed on the final failed attempt.

session token of fahap-hawip = htk31_7852f2b3276dba2738f98fa97f92237